Hi ,
in Kate there is also a nice autocompletion plugin.
I strongly suggest it.

> > I use Kate (a KDE text editor) under Kubuntu or
> RedHat 8 and simply leave
> > the file open as I work. Once I save changes to
> an Octave executable file,
> > I can run them in Octave from the command line.
> Moving back and forth
> > between the shell and Kate is quick. Not quite an
> IDE, but it's trouble
> > free and convenient.
>
> In fact it's possible to open a Terminal inside
> Kate. That makes the work
> easier and faster, no need to move between windows.
> And Kate can highlight
> Octave syntax too.
